“Noah”, Japan’s Mini-Arks

Posted on January 22, 2012 by Rick SpilmanJanuary 22, 2012

Cosmo Power, a Japanese engineering company, has developed the “Noah” a four person mini-ark to help residents along Japan’s coast survive a future tsunami.  The “Noah” is  a four foot diameter bright yellow sphere made of fiber-reinforced plastic. It is self righting … Continue reading →
